The Evolving Landscape of AI: Trends and Advancements
The field of Artificial Intelligence continues to evolve at an unprecedented pace. Emerging trends and advancements are reshaping various industries, from healthcare to finance, and driving innovation across the globe. Machine learning algorithms are becoming increasingly sophisticated, enabling AI systems to analyze vast amounts of data, identify patterns, and make intelligent decisions. Natural language processing (NLP) is also making strides, allowing AI to understand and generate human language with greater accuracy.
One notable trend is the rise of explainable AI (XAI), which aims to make AI decisions more transparent and understandable to humans. Furthermore, there's growing interest in ethical considerations surrounding AI, including bias mitigation and responsible development. As AI continues to integrate into our lives, it's crucial to address these challenges and ensure that AI technologies are used ethically and for the benefit of humanity.
Uses of Artificial Intelligence in Everyday Life
Artificial intelligence (AI) is quickly changing the way we live our lives. From smartphones to cars, AI fuels a wide range of applications that simplify our daily routines.
One common instance is virtual assistants, like Siri or Alexa, which use AI to process our voice commands and perform tasks Artificial intelligence technologies such as setting reminders, playing music, or controlling smart home devices. AI also plays a important role in recommendation systems used by streaming services to propose content and products tailored to our preferences.
- Furthermore, AI is implemented in healthcare to diagnose diseases.
- Moreover, AI-powered tools are transforming the field of education by personalizing learning experiences.
As a result, AI is becoming increasingly integrated into our lives, offering numerous benefits and opportunities for efficiency in various fields.
Ethical Considerations in AI Development and Deployment
The rapid advancement of artificial intelligence (AI) presents tremendous opportunities throughout various industries. However, it also raises critical ethical considerations that must be carefully addressed during both the development and deployment phases. Transparency, accountability, and fairness are key principles that shape responsible AI practices. Developers must strive to create AI systems that are interpretable to humans, allowing for assessment. Furthermore, it is essential to mitigate bias in AI algorithms to ensure equitable outcomes for all. Comprehensive testing and monitoring are necessary to uncover potential ethical dilemmas and enforce safeguards against unintended consequences.
- Fostering ethical AI development requires collaboration between engineers, policymakers, and citizens.
- Ongoing education initiatives are crucial to cultivate a shared understanding of ethical AI principles.
- By embracing these considerations, we can strive to leverage the possibilities of AI while minimizing its potential challenges.
